Floor Polishing in Nashua, NH
Floor polishing services involve restoring the shine and smoothness of various types of flooring, including hardwood, marble, terrazzo, and concrete surfaces. This process typically includes grinding, buffing, and applying protective finishes to enhance the appearance and durability of the floors. Homeowners often request this service to revitalize worn or dull floors, prepare surfaces for new projects, or improve the overall aesthetic of residential spaces. It is commonly used for both interior and exterior projects, such as living rooms, kitchens, entryways, and patios.
Property owners should consider factors such as the type of flooring material, existing surface condition, and desired finish before requesting floor polishing. Understanding these details can help determine the appropriate techniques and products to achieve the best results. Additionally, it is helpful to inquire about the scope of work, including whether surface repairs or sealing are included, to ensure the project aligns with specific renovation or maintenance goals. Proper preparation and clear communication can contribute to a successful and satisfying outcome.

Floor Polishing Questions
What types of floors can be polished? Floor polishing can be performed on various surfaces including hardwood, concrete, marble, and terrazzo to restore shine and smoothness.
Is floor polishing suitable for damaged floors? Yes, polishing can help improve the appearance of minor scratches and surface imperfections, enhancing the overall look of the floor.
How often should floors be polished? The frequency depends on foot traffic and wear, but generally, floors can be polished every few years to maintain their appearance.
What should property owners consider before polishing? It's important to evaluate the floor’s current condition and type to determine the appropriate polishing method and finish for best results.
